What Makes an Online Casino Trustworthy?

Trust begins with clear information. A reputable casino should identify its operating company, display licensing details, explain its privacy practices, and publish understandable terms and conditions. Licensing does not guarantee that every experience will be perfect, but it indicates that the operator is expected to follow established standards concerning player protection, fair play, and financial procedures.

Security is equally important. Look for encrypted connections, secure account verification, and sensible controls for deposits and withdrawals. A dependable website should never request unnecessary personal information or make its payment policies difficult to understand. Players should also check whether the casino supports responsible gambling tools, including deposit limits, cooling-off periods, reality checks, and self-exclusion options.

Key Trust Signals to Check

  • A clearly displayed licence and operator identity
  • Secure website connections and protected payment processing
  • Independent testing of casino games and random number generators
  • Transparent bonus, wagering, withdrawal, and identity-check terms
  • Accessible customer service through several contact methods

Comparing Games, Software, and Mobile Access

A broad game catalogue gives players more choice, but quantity alone should not determine a decision. Strong casinos usually offer titles from established software studios, covering popular slots, table games, live dealer rooms, jackpots, and specialty games. Variety is most valuable when the games are easy to find, load reliably, and include accurate information about rules, paylines, limits, and return-to-player percentages.

Mobile compatibility has also become essential. A well-designed casino should work smoothly on current smartphones and tablets without requiring complicated downloads. Menus should remain easy to use on smaller screens, while the cashier and account areas should offer the same core functions available on desktop. Players who enjoy live casino games should also consider video quality, table availability, betting limits, and dealer interaction.

Feature What to Compare Why It Matters
Game selection Slots, table games, live casino, jackpots Provides choice for different interests and budgets
Software quality Recognised studios, tested game mechanics Supports fair and consistent gameplay
Mobile experience Responsive design, quick loading, simple navigation Makes play more convenient on portable devices
Game information Rules, limits, RTP details, bonus features Helps players understand a title before wagering

Bonuses and Promotions: Read the Full Terms

Bonuses can add value, but they should never be judged by the headline amount alone. A welcome offer may include a deposit match, free spins, cashback, or a combination of rewards. Before accepting any promotion, players should review the minimum deposit, wagering requirement, maximum bet rule, eligible games, expiry date, and maximum permitted withdrawal. Restrictions may also apply to payment methods, bonus conversion, and account verification.

Wagering requirements describe how many times qualifying funds must be played through before a bonus or associated winnings can be withdrawn. A lower requirement is generally easier to manage, but the overall value depends on the contribution rate of each game and any additional restrictions. Promotional balances can also expire quickly, so keeping a record of important dates is useful.

Questions to Ask Before Claiming an Offer

  • Is the promotion available in my location?
  • How much must be deposited to qualify?
  • What is the wagering requirement and which games contribute?
  • Is there a maximum bet while the bonus is active?
  • When does the offer expire?
  • Can the bonus be declined or removed without affecting deposited funds?

Deposits, Withdrawals, and Customer Support

Payment convenience can have a major effect on the overall experience. Good casinos normally support several trusted methods, such as bank cards, bank transfers, electronic wallets, and selected local options. Each method may have different processing times, fees, minimums, and verification rules. Players should review these details before depositing rather than waiting until they request a withdrawal.

Withdrawal policies deserve particular attention. Check whether the casino imposes daily or monthly limits, whether pending periods apply, and which documents may be needed for identity verification. Legitimate operators may request proof of identity or payment ownership, especially before a first withdrawal. While verification can be inconvenient, clear procedures and reasonable processing times are positive signs.

Customer support should be easy to reach when questions arise. Live chat is often the quickest option, while email can be useful for formal requests that require documentation. Before registering, test the support channel with a basic question and assess whether the reply is accurate, polite, and specific. A detailed help centre is another indication that the operator values transparency.

Responsible Gambling Should Come First

Online casino games are designed for entertainment, not guaranteed income. Players should set a budget before starting, avoid using money needed for essential expenses, and treat losses as part of the cost of entertainment. Chasing losses, increasing stakes to recover money, or playing while distressed can lead to harmful patterns.

Useful safeguards include deposit limits, session reminders, spending reviews, and temporary breaks. Players who feel that gambling is becoming difficult to control should use self-exclusion tools and seek support from an appropriate professional or recognised gambling-help organisation. Choosing a casino that actively provides these features is an important part of making a responsible decision.
